The Neighbors’ Place: Guest Intake. Volunteers will work outdoors and collect basic household information from guests. They will then bring a pre-packed grocery cart to a table where guests will load their groceries into their own vehicles. Faith in Action: Volunteer Drivers. Faith in Action provides rides to medical appointments for seniors in our area. They also provide grocery shopping for seniors in need. Contact Jamie at 715-848 8783 or [email protected].
